Job Summary
We are seeking a detail-oriented and analytical Business Analyst to join our team. The ideal candidate will play a critical role in bridging business needs with technological solutions by analyzing data, designing processes, and supporting project initiatives. This position offers an opportunity to work on diverse projects that drive strategic decision-making and operational efficiency. The Business Analyst will collaborate with cross-functional teams to deliver actionable insights and innovative solutions, utilizing a broad skill set including data analysis, project management, and technical expertise.
Responsibilities
- Gather and document business requirements through stakeholder interviews, workshops, and analysis.
- Develop detailed reports and dashboards using tools such as Tableau, Power BI, and Excel VBA to visualize key metrics.
- Support project management activities within Agile frameworks, ensuring timely delivery of solutions aligned with SDLC best practices.
- Design and optimize databases, including Microsoft SQL Server and Oracle, ensuring data integrity and efficiency.
- Conduct comprehensive data analysis using SQL, R, Python, and Bash (Unix shell) to identify trends, patterns, and insights.
- Collaborate with technical teams on database design, system integration, and application development.
- Create process models and diagrams using Visio to illustrate workflows and system architecture.
- Assist in the development of analytics models to support business strategies and operational improvements.
- Participate in analysis of system requirements for new projects or enhancements, ensuring alignment with business goals.
Skills
- Proficiency in Tableau, Power BI for data visualization.
- Strong understanding of Agile methodologies and project management principles.
- Experience with SDLC processes for software development lifecycle management.
- Programming skills in R, Python, VBA, Bash (Unix shell).
- Expertise in database management systems including Microsoft SQL Server and Oracle.
- Solid knowledge of business analysis techniques and tools such as Visio.
- Data analysis skills with the ability to interpret complex datasets accurately.
- Familiarity with database design principles and data modeling techniques.
- Excellent analysis skills to synthesize information from multiple sources into clear insights. This role is ideal for a proactive professional passionate about leveraging data to influence business decisions while working in a collaborative environment that values innovation and continuous improvement.
Pay: $30.00-$50.00 per hour
Work Location: Hybrid remote in Greater Toronto Area, ON